Originally Posted by dingla rs
how dos it set up with the strut tops were they are(front) then just intrested as its 4x4 ,looks good so far
Exactly what i was asking Andy
It does'nt look like the front suspension mounts have been moved in to replicate the sierra ones so the front shocks may be standing up to straight
every 4x4 focus ive seen has had the strut tops moved in to 40" centres from the focus setting of 42"


Shaun have you mocked the front suspension in?

Only trying to help and learn not picking faults
